Abstract
A communication information detecting device includes: a receiving unit that receives an address resolution request message transmitted from a start-point communication device through L2 broadcast and having an IP address of a target communication device set therein as a target address for L2 address resolution; a generating unit that generates an address resolution request message having the IPv6 address of the target communication device, which is set in the received address resolution request message, set therein as a target address for L2 address resolution; a follow-up processing unit that transmits this address resolution request message through L2 broadcast; a receiving unit that receives an address resolution reply message returned from the target communication device in response to the address resolution request message; and a detecting unit that extracts an L2 address and an IP address concerning the target communication device from the address resolution reply message.
